From 8731ffa23863df1290d5349f6c7ec395ea4634a3 Mon Sep 17 00:00:00 2001 From: Mike Blumenkrantz Date: Fri, 12 Aug 2022 11:09:06 -0400 Subject: [PATCH] zink: stop zeroing local size if current compute doesn't use it this just complicates things for later compute updates Reviewed-by: Dave Airlie Part-of: --- src/gallium/drivers/zink/zink_program.c |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/src/gallium/drivers/zink/zink_program.c b/src/gallium/drivers/zink/zink_program.c index 7e016bd971b..547b51634a4 100644 --- a/src/gallium/drivers/zink/zink_program.c +++ b/src/gallium/drivers/zink/zink_program.c @@ -710,10 +710,7 @@ zink_program_update_compute_pipeline_state(struct zink_context *ctx, struct zink ctx->compute_pipeline_state.dirty = true; ctx->compute_pipeline_state.local_size[i] = block[i]; } - } else - ctx->compute_pipeline_state.local_size[0] = - ctx->compute_pipeline_state.local_size[1] = - ctx->compute_pipeline_state.local_size[2] = 0; + } } static bool